An integrated, interdisciplinary unit on American Gothic with a focus on Edgar Allen Poe. Students in English III will be introduced to the late 18th and 19th century Gothic tradition and its revival in the 20th century. Focusing on Edgar Allen Poe in an author study, students will gather information about his life, gaining insight into the real person behind his famous poems and stories. Influences of math/science into his works. Appreciate the craft on one of America's most renowed writers and gain information on Poe's impact on the genres poetry, short fiction, and the detective story. Gothic tradition will be traced through Southern Gothic to modern writing. Emphasis on the development of the horror story in film will be pursued.
